complement fixation test

Broader Terms:

serology /serodiagnosis

Scope Note:

serologic tests based on inactivation of complement by the antigen-antibody complex (stage 1); binding of free complement can be visualized by addition of a second antigen-antibody system such as red cells and appropriate red cell antibody (hemolysin) requiring complement for its completion (stage 2); failure of the red cells to lyse indicates that a specific antigen-antibody reaction has taken place in stage 1; if red cells lyse, free complement is present indicating no antigen-antibody reaction occurred in stage 1.
